22923 JAM Humsafar Schedule, Routes & Time Table

Station CodeStation NameArrivalDepartureHaltKm
BDTSMumbai Bandra Terminus-23:5500:000 km
BVIBorivali00:2000:2505:0019 km
VAPIVapi02:1602:1802:00159 km
STSurat04:0404:0905:00252 km
BHBharuch Jn04:4704:4902:00311 km
BRCVadodara Jn05:4405:4905:00381 km
ANNDAnand Jn06:2106:2302:00417 km
ADIAhmedabad Jn07:4507:5005:00481 km
VGViramgam Jn09:0009:0202:00546 km
SUNRSurendranagar10:0610:0802:00611 km
WKRWankaner Jn11:0211:0402:00686 km
RJTRajkot Jn12:0212:1210:00727 km
HAPAHapa13:2413:2602:00804 km
JAMJamnagar14:20-00:00812 km

Understanding Seat Availability Status

When you are planning to travel by train and want to check the availability of seats, it is important to understand the different types of waiting lists that you may encounter while booking your ticket. Here are the common terms you need to know:

Waiting List (WL)
When a ticket is booked and all the seats and berths are taken, it is assigned a WL status, which stands for ‘waitlist’ or ‘waiting list’. This means that your ticket is on a waiting list, and you will have to wait for other passengers to cancel their tickets before your ticket gets confirmed. The most common waiting list code, WL tickets have a high likelihood of getting confirmed. For example, if the ticket reads General Waiting List 7/WL 6, GNWL means you are number 6 on the waiting list and will be confirmed after the cancellation of tickets of 6 other passengers.

General Waiting List (GNWL)
GNWL tickets are waitlisted and issued only if a passenger cancels their confirmed booking. These tickets are issued to passengers who start their journey from the originating station or nearby stations, and they have a high chance of being confirmed. This type of waiting list is common for train tickets.

Pooled Quota Waiting List (PQWL)
PQWL tickets are categorized when a long-distance train stops between two stations. This particular status is a specific pooling quota that covers several small stations. If a confirmed ticket is cancelled at a station, the chances of PQWL confirmation are higher.

Reservation Against Cancellation (RAC)
RAC means Reservation Against Cancellation. In RAC, two passengers are allowed to travel on one berth. If passengers with a confirmed ticket do not travel, their berth is offered to other passengers as RAC.

Roadside Station Waiting List (RSWL)
RSWL is assigned when a ticket is booked from originating stations to roadside or nearby stations. The likelihood of such waiting list tickets getting confirmed is very low.

Tatkal Quota Waiting List (TQWL)
TQWL is given to tickets booked under the Tatkal scheme that end up on the waiting list. These waiting list tickets have a very low chance of getting confirmed.

No Seat Berth (NOSB)
For children under 12 years of age, the railway charges child fare but does not allocate a seat. In such cases, the PNR status shows an NOSB code.

Remote Location Waiting List (RLWL)
Tickets on the Remote Location Waiting List have the highest chance of getting confirmed. This is a quota for berths for smaller stations, and waiting list tickets are categorized as RLWL at intermediate stations. However, it is important to note that RLWL tickets have lower chances of confirmation compared to GNWL or RAC tickets.

Understanding these different types of waiting lists will help you navigate the process of booking your train ticket more efficiently and with a clearer understanding of the likelihood of your ticket getting confirmed.
